Importance of Warm-Up Activities
After a long, cold winter, both muscles and ligaments can become stiff. Before starting your workout, it is essential to engage in sufficient warm-up activities. This includes mobilizing your waist and limb joints, as well as massaging hands, face, and ears to stimulate blood circulation. Such actions can greatly reduce the risk of muscle strains and ligament injuries during exercise.
Dress Appropriately for Changing Weather
Spring brings unpredictable weather patterns, particularly in early spring, where temperatures can fluctuate significantly. Therefore, when exercising outdoors, it is imperative to dress appropriately to prevent chills. Always pay attention to your body temperature; after sweating, dry yourself with a towel and promptly change into warmer clothing to avoid post-exercise discomfort.
Guidelines for Maintaining Body Warmth
When participating in outdoor activities during early spring, ensure that you layer your clothing adequately. Utilizing moisture-wicking materials can help keep you dry and warm. This way, you can effectively reduce the chances of getting cold after sweating and enjoy your exercise routine safely.
Balancing Exercise Intensity
As the weather becomes cooler, it is vital to balance your exercise intensity. Overdoing your workout can lead to excessive sweating, and exposing your body to cold air afterward may increase the risk of colds and respiratory issues. Conversely, not engaging in enough physical activity fails to achieve your fitness goals.
Experts recommend a daily workout duration of 30 minutes to one hour. This range is sufficient to keep your body active and healthy while allowing time for recovery and adaptation to the changing climate.
